Foundations Join Forces on January 1, 2010

The Norfolk Foundation and The Virginia Beach Foundation finalized their merger on January 1, 2010 and debuted the Hampton Roads Community Foundation. The community foundation is the largest grant and scholarship provider in the Hampton Roads region of Virginia. Harry T. Lester, president of Eastern Virginia Medical School, is chair of the foundation's 12-member board of directors.

Foundation Grants Top $13.7 Million in 2009

The Norfolk Foundation and The Virginia Beach Foundation awarded $13.7 million in grants and scholarships in 2009. The two foundations merged on January 1, 2010 to form the Hampton Roads Community Foundation. Click here for a list of 2009 grant recipients.

Final Round of Grants Helps 17 Nonprofits

The Norfolk Foundation (now the Hampton Roads Community Foundation) awarded more than $12 million in grants and scholarships in 2009 – the largest amount given by the foundation in a single year.

Charitable Giving Study Focuses on Hampton Roads

Nonprofits in the Hampton Roads region had a challenging year in 2009, according to the eighth annual Dimensions of Philanthropy in Hampton Roads  study. It was published in November 2009 by the Hampton Roads Association of Fundraising Professionals, Hampton Roads chapter, Bonney & Company and The Norfolk Foundation (now the Hampton Roads Community Foundation).
